Transaction ddf161e41e3b196299bdc63c39bd1472a384bb7bbfdc7b44b7e1b133b0408098
1 Input
1 Output
-
ddf161e41e3b196299bdc63c39bd1472a384bb7bbfdc7b44b7e1b133b0408098:0
- value
- 342006
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4b07e6c5a981a77cb3350a1d8e8a782a9ed5a7d
- address
- bc1qcjc8umz6nqd80jen2zsa3698s2576knae7kyr2